Parkinson's Disease
A neurodegenerative disorder that affects movement, causing symptoms such as tremors, stiffness, and slow movements.
Axon
A long, slender projection of a nerve cell, or neuron, that typically conducts electrical impulses away from the neuron's cell body.
Postsynaptic Neuron
A neuron that receives a signal (via neurotransmitter molecules) from another neuron at a synapse.
Action Potential
A temporary reversal of the electrical polarity of the neuron's membrane, facilitating the transmission of nerve impulses.
